From: LPS-preconditioned mesenchymal stromal cells modify macrophage polarization for resolution of chronic inflammation via exosome-shuttled let-7b

Unsupervised hierarchical cluster analysis of miRNA expression in LPS pre-Exo uncovers let-7b as a regulator of TLR4 in macrophage polarization. a miRNA expression profiling on total RNA isolated from un-Exo (n = 3) and LPS pre-Exo (n = 3). A heatmap was generated after supervised hierarchical cluster analysis. Differential miRNA expression is shown by red (upregulation) versus green (downregulation) intensity (LPS pre-Exo versus un-Exo, twofold change, p < 0.05). b Validation of unique miRNAs in LPS pre-Exo using real-time RT-PCR. c Real-time RT-PCR analysis of let-7b expression in treated THP-1 cells at 48 h. Data are presented as the mean ± SEM of three separate experiments. *Compared with Con, p < 0.05; #compared with HG, p < 0.05. d Immunofluorescence staining displayed TLR4 activity in treated THP-1 cells at 48 h
